Abstract :
A sample of Eu3+-activated lutetium sesquioxide transparent ceramic has been investigated by combined scintillation and thermoluminescence excited by prolonged gamma-ray irradiation. The thermoluminescence glow curve partially confirms and extends a previous model for afterglow following pulsed X-ray excitation. The initial concentration of hole traps, tentatively attributed to anion Frenkel defects in thermodynamic equilibrium, is found to be substantially augmented by reversible radiation damage.
